The Mission Statement is a short document that sets out the ethos, way of working and ultimate aim of your business. Many are as short as two paragraphs. An example of a service based company would be: To aim to serve our customers quickly and efficiently, garnering only respect and loyalty. A company that is more focussed on low prices may have a Mission Statement that states: We aim to offer the lowest prices in our market place such that we gain the maximum market share without compromising the quality of our services or lose the respect of our customers.
As you can see a company’s mission statement feeds down to staff priorities, product qualitative and pricing, customer service aims, technology employed and market share being pursued. In this course we will explore major company vision statements and teach you how to define your mission statement.
Think of a company such as Ryan Air or South West Airlines which focuses on low costs and compare it with a service based company such as Rolls Royce, Marks and Spencer, SkyLofts at MGM Grand and you can see how their different Mission Statements affects the service and products they provide.
So what is a business strategic plan? Basically, it is a combination of what you want your business to be and a roadmap to get there, it includes the following:
- Company Vision
- Core Values
- Company Objectives
- Company Strategic Plan
